
Stefanos Tsitsipas defeated Hubert Hurkatz 7-6(8), 6-3 and advanced to the semi-finals of the tournament in Astana. The best Greek tennis player in the first set pressed his back against the wall, but came back great.
Stefanos Tsitsipas will face Andrey Rublev in the semi-finals.
The best Greek tennis player had four break opportunities in the seventh game of the first set, but Hurkatz held on, albeit with difficulty. Tsitsipas had a better chance when the two tennis players resolved their differences in the first set in a tiebreak.
Hurkach made a mini-break with the score 2:4 and served to win the set. However, Stefanos Tsitsipas “erased” the opponent’s five sets and with great disappointment made the score 1:0.
The second set was the same. Stefanos Tsitsipas made a 5-3 break and then won on his serve.
